This is a single-story detached house built in 1950, offering 3 bedrooms, 1 bathroom, and 1 car space on a 505 square metre block with 80 square metres of internal living area. It includes solar panels, air conditioning, and a dishwasher. What is competitively strong here is the land-to-house ratio. A 505 square metre block in Heidelberg Heights with a single-story 1950s house is increasingly rare, especially at this price point. The property sits in a stable, low-density residential pocket that attracts families and first-home buyers looking for space without the premium of a full renovation project. The solar system and dishwasher are practical additions that reduce immediate outlay. This house serves best the buyer who values land holding potential over polished finishes — someone willing to live in a modest home while the site appreciates. Its positioning within the suburb is slightly below the typical family offering, but that is exactly its edge: it offers entry into a desirable postcode without the price tag of a larger home. The conflicting bedroom count across sources may affect how the market values the property. If it is genuinely a 2-bedroom house, its appeal narrows to couples or investors rather than families, which could soften demand. The 1950s build may require updating to modern standards, particularly in insulation, wiring, or plumbing. A buyer should weigh the cost of these improvements against the land value. The smaller internal footprint might also limit financing options for some purchasers. These factors may influence how quickly the property sells and at what final price, but they do not diminish the fundamental strength of the land holding in this location.

Market Insight

Heidelberg Heights offers a relatively affordable entry point into Melbourne’s established north-eastern suburbs, attracting young families and professionals drawn by its connectivity to key transport corridors and employment hubs. Demand is driven by owner-occupiers and investors, the latter particularly focused on units for their higher rental yields. Recent price trends for houses have been mixed with some softening, while the unit market faces its own pressures, reflecting broader affordability constraints and interest rate sensitivity. Future appeal hinges on its established infrastructure and school catchments, though its growth is tempered by these same economic headwinds impacting buyer capacity.
